Easing in animation is a fundamental concept that breathes life into motion graphics and digital storytelling. Imagine creating motion graphics without smooth transitions or controlled pacing.
That’s where easing comes into play, controlling the way animations accelerate or decelerate to create more realistic and engaging visuals.
By the end of this article, you’ll understand what easing in animation is, and how it enhances your motion designs. We’ll dive into keyframes, Bezier curves, and the different types of easing methods like ease-in and ease-out.
I’ll also touch on animation software like Adobe After Effects and libraries like GSAP, which offer various easing presets and customization options.
From mastering timing functions to perfecting motion paths, easing can transform your animations.
Whether you’re working on an interactive design or visual storytelling project, understanding easing is crucial for achieving fluid and natural motion. Let’s explore the principles and techniques that will elevate your animation skills.
What Is Easing in Animation?
Easing in animation is the gradual acceleration or deceleration of motion, making transitions appear more natural and less abrupt. It mimics real-world physics, adding realism and fluidity to movements. Easing enhances the viewer’s experience by creating smoother animations, emphasizing key actions, and improving the overall visual appeal.
Types of Easing Techniques
Ease-in
Definition: Slow start, fast finish.
Ease-in techniques are fundamental for generating convincing motions. When actions need to begin slowly and then accelerate, ease-in is the go-to. This technique often finds its place in starting motions and scenarios requiring soft accelerations, enhancing realism.
Common applications in animation:
- Starting motions
- Soft accelerations
Ease-in builds anticipation and momentum. You see this kind of motion in CSS3 animations and JavaScript animation libraries, where the start is deliberately slow, gathering speed as it progresses.
Ease-out
Definition: Fast start, slow finish.
Ease-out comes into play when you need a motion that begins quickly and then decelerates. This technique is common in UI and digital animations, making interactions more natural by slowing down as they come to a halt.
Use cases in UI and digital animation:
- Deceleration towards stops
- Enhancing buttons and sliders
Ease-out enhances responsiveness and simulates natural deceleration, making actions appear more intuitive and fluid. Using Velocity.js and GreenSock Animation Platform (GSAP), you achieve seamless transitions in web animations, making users feel the interface is highly responsive.
Ease-in-out
Definition: Smooth acceleration and deceleration.
Ease-in-out combines the characteristics of both ease-in and ease-out. It’s utilized in continuous motions that require a natural start and end, reducing abruptness.
Best situations to use ease-in-out:
- Continuous motions
- Transitional effects
This technique impacts visual fluidity and user perception significantly. Using tools like Adobe After Effects and Blender, you can manipulate easing curves to maintain a smooth flow through animations.
Linear Motion (for Contrast)
What linear motion is: Consistent speed throughout.
Linear motion keeps a steady pace from start to finish, unlike easing, which varies the speed. This kind of motion often feels robotic and jarring, lacking the organic feel presented by easing techniques.
Why linear motion often feels robotic and jarring:
- Consistent, unvarying speed
- Lack of realism
Comparison of user reactions to linear vs. eased animations:
Eased animations create smoother transitions and convey a sense of realism and engagement.
In contrast, linear motion often results in less natural interaction, missing elements like momentum and deceleration.
In user interfaces, linear motion can feel unnaturally abrupt and distract users, reducing overall experience quality.
Practical Applications of Easing in Digital Animation
Keyframes and Easing in Software
Easing through keyframes involves setting different points in an animation timeline. Tools like Adobe After Effects and Blender offer options to adjust timing precisely.
Adjusting keyframe interpolation lets you control the easing speed. Moving keyframes closer or farther apart alters the perceived speed and fluidity.
Easing curves play a pivotal role. They define the rate of change over time, essential for animating complex objects. By tweaking these curves in the graph editor, animators can craft nuanced motions, from a speeding car to a bouncing ball.
- Bezier curves: Highly flexible, allowing for customized easing.
Avoiding rigid, linear movements is key to creating engaging animations. Whether you’re working with HTML5 animations or Lottie files, easing transforms basic actions into experiences that feel real and responsive.
Understanding Easing Curves
What Are Easing Curves?
Definition and function of easing curves in digital animation: Easing curves define how an animation progresses over time.
In essence, they map the rate of change to the timeline. This means controlling how an object accelerates and decelerates within its motion.
Visualizing easing curves: Think of these as acceleration and deceleration graphs.
A steep curve means fast movements, while a gentle slope indicates slower transitions. This can simplify understanding what is easing in animation.
Types of Easing Curves
Linear curves vs. eased curves: Linear curves keep an unchanging, robotic pace — no acceleration or deceleration. In contrast, eased curves modulate speed, delivering more lifelike motion.
Commonly used curves in animation tools like Adobe After Effects or Blender:
- Ease-in: Slow start, accelerating after.
- Ease-out: Fast start, slowing towards the end.
- Ease-in-out: Combines both, for a smooth entry and exit.
Custom easing curves allow advanced animations for those looking to create unique effects. Tools like GSAP or Anime.js enable fine-tuning beyond standard presets.
How to Adjust Easing Curves in Animation Tools
Practical guide to modifying easing curves in popular software:
- In Adobe After Effects: Access the graph editor, select your keyframes, and manually adjust their Bezier handles to modify the curve.
- In Blender: Use the F-curve editor. Select the keyframe, then tweak the handles to get the desired easing effect.
Tips for creating smooth and realistic transitions: Always preview your animation. Adjust little by little and keep an eye on the motion path to ensure fluidity.
Benefits of Using Easing in Animation
Enhancing Realism in Animated Movement
Why easing mimics real-world physics:
Easing techniques replicate the way objects accelerate and decelerate in the real world. When a ball drops, it doesn’t just plummet at a constant speed. Gravity pulls it down faster and faster, until it bounces and slows.
How easing creates believable weight and momentum:
By adjusting the speed of an animation over time, easing allows us to create the illusion of mass and inertia.
For instance, an object easing out mimics how it might slow down to a halt, just like a car braking smoothly. You get the sense that there’s a genuine force behind the motion.
Improving User Experience
Impact of easing on user interface navigation:
When it comes to user interfaces, easing makes all the difference.
Clicking a button that instantly completes an action feels jarring. Instead, an ease-out motion creates a soft landing, enhancing the feeling of responsiveness.
Easing as a tool for creating intuitive, less jarring experiences:
Eased animations guide user attention and make interactions feel natural.
Consider a dropdown menu — an ease-in animation makes the appearance less abrupt, easing out ensures it doesn’t just disappear. It’s these subtle touches that make digital spaces feel more human.
Boosting Engagement Through Smoother Transitions
How proper easing keeps users engaged by making interactions feel fluid:
Imagine every click, swipe, or scroll met with sharp, linear motions.
It’d be off-putting. Easing creates smooth transitions, leading to a better overall experience. Users stay longer when interactions are pleasant.
Easing’s role in storytelling and emotional pacing in animation:
In storytelling, timing is everything. Easing helps set the pace. Consider a character running and then slowing to a walk; easing makes this transition believable and emotionally resonant.
Whether it’s a fast-paced chase or a slow, dramatic reveal, easing enhances the narrative flow.
Key Considerations for Effective Easing
Choosing the Right Easing Technique
Matching easing types to object motion and narrative intent: It’s all about the story you want to tell and how you want your objects to behave.
- Ease-in fits when you need actions to gradually pick up speed. Think of it as gearing up: starting a car, a character standing up. It’s the anticipation of motion.
- Ease-out is your go-to for actions that need soft landings. Imagine a ball rolling to a gentle stop, or a spacecraft coming to rest. It’s the natural slowdown that feels just right.
When to use ease-in vs. ease-out for specific scenarios: Use ease-in for rising action, and ease-out for concluding it. When both are needed, go with ease-in-out for balanced acceleration and deceleration in continuous motions.
Duration and Speed of Easing
How the length of easing affects the perception of speed: Longer easing curves feel smoother but can drag. Shorter ones are snappy but risk being too abrupt. Balance is key.
- Long durations: Good for dramatic, slow-paced narratives. Shows weight and makes elements appear heavy or significant.
- Short durations: Ideal for quick interactions. Makes elements feel light and responsive, like tapping a button on a user interface.
Avoiding overly long or short animations that feel unnatural: Test and tweak. Overly long animations? They might bore your viewers. Too short? They risk losing the message. Aim for a sweet spot.
Common Mistakes to Avoid
Overuse of easing leading to sluggish or unresponsive animation: Easing everywhere can bog things down. Your UI starts to crawl, and users get frustrated. Not everything needs to glide smoothly.
Choosing linear motion for elements that should feel fluid: Linear motion feels robotic, devoid of life. Especially in UI elements or motion graphics, a linear transition can be jarring. Reserve linear for precise, mechanical actions or when exact timing matters.
FAQ on Easing In Animation
Why is easing important in animation?
Easing adds a realistic feel to animations, making transitions smooth and natural. It avoids mechanical and abrupt movements by controlling the object’s speed.
Using easing helps in creating a more engaging user interface and storytelling experience, enhancing the overall quality and appeal of the animation.
How does easing differ from linear motion?
Easing involves acceleration and deceleration, while linear motion maintains a constant speed.
Easing techniques such as ease-in, ease-out, and ease-in-out are used to create more dynamic and lifelike movements, whereas linear motion often results in stiff and unnatural animations.
What are the common types of easing?
Common types of easing include ease-in, ease-out, and ease-in-out. Ease-in starts slowly and speeds up, ease-out starts fast and slows down, and ease-in-out combines both, starting slow, speeding up, and then slowing down again. These methods enhance the timing and spacing of animations.
How do you apply easing in animation software?
In animation software like Adobe After Effects or Toon Boom Harmony, you apply easing by manipulating keyframes and adjusting the animation curves.
Tools like the graph editor or timeline editor allow you to tweak Bezier curves and interpolation settings to achieve the desired easing effect.
What are Bezier curves in easing?
Bezier curves are mathematical curves used to create smooth transitions in animations. By adjusting the control points of a Bezier curve, animators can precisely control the timing and spacing of an animation, achieving complex easing effects. These curves are fundamental in tools like the graph editor.
What is an ease-in effect?
An ease-in effect starts an animation slowly and then speeds up. It’s useful for scenarios where an object needs to gain momentum, such as a car accelerating.
This effect can be created by adjusting the timing functions and keyframes, providing a natural start to the motion.
What is an ease-out effect?
An ease-out effect begins quickly and then slows down. This is ideal for animations that require a smooth conclusion, like a character coming to a stop.
By manipulating keyframes and animation curves, animators can control the deceleration, creating fluid and realistic endings to movements.
How do easing presets work?
Easing presets are predefined easing effects available in animation software. They simplify the process by offering ready-to-use easing functions like ease-in, ease-out, bounce, and elastic.
These presets can be applied to keyframes, allowing animators to quickly implement complex easing effects.
Can easing be customized?
Yes, easing can be customized by modifying the animation curves manually. Using tools like the graph editor, animators can adjust the control points of Bezier curves or create custom interpolation settings to achieve specific easing effects. This allows for extensive creative control over the animation’s timing.
Conclusion
Understanding what is easing in animation is essential for creating fluid, natural movement in your projects. Easing involves adjusting the speed of animations, using concepts like acceleration and deceleration. These techniques are crucial for achieving realistic motion, whether it’s an interface animation or a complex digital storytelling piece.
By mastering keyframes, Bezier curves, and various types of easing—such as ease-in and ease-out—you can control the timing and spacing of animations, enhancing their overall impact.
Animation tools like Adobe After Effects and libraries such as GSAP provide numerous presets and customization options, allowing you to fine-tune your easing effects.
Easing transforms static motion into dynamic, lifelike experiences. From smooth transitions to realistic motion paths, it allows for a higher level of control and expression in animation.
Implementing these principles can significantly improve the quality and engagement of your motion graphics, making them more enjoyable for viewers while achieving more polished results.
By grasping these fundamental elements, you can elevate your animation work, making it more impactful and visually appealing.